黑狐家游戏

关系数据库最基本的数据单位是什么,关系数据库最基本的数据单位是

欧气 3 0

标题:探索关系数据库中最基本的数据单位

在关系数据库中,最基本的数据单位是关系(Relation),关系是一张二维表,其中每行代表一个实体,每列代表一个属性,关系数据库通过关系模型来组织和管理数据,关系模型是一种数学模型,它将数据表示为一组关系,每个关系都有一个唯一的名称和一个属性列表。

关系数据库的基本概念包括:

1、实体:实体是现实世界中可以被区别和识别的事物,学生、教师、课程等都是实体。

2、属性:属性是实体的特征或性质,学生的学号、姓名、年龄等都是属性。

3、关系:关系是实体之间的联系,学生和课程之间的选课关系就是一个关系。

4、元组:元组是关系中的一行数据,代表一个实体的信息,学生关系中的一个元组就是一个学生的信息。

5、属性值:属性值是元组中对应属性的具体值,学生关系中某个学生的学号、姓名、年龄等属性值。

关系数据库的优点包括:

1、数据结构简单:关系数据库的基本数据单位是关系,关系是一张二维表,数据结构简单,易于理解和使用。

2、数据独立性高:关系数据库将数据和程序分离,数据的逻辑结构和物理结构相互独立,提高了数据的独立性和灵活性。

3、数据一致性好:关系数据库通过关系模型来组织和管理数据,关系模型具有严格的数学定义和约束条件,保证了数据的一致性和完整性。

4、数据操作方便:关系数据库提供了丰富的数据操作语言,如 SQL,使得数据的查询、插入、更新和删除等操作非常方便。

5、支持多用户并发访问:关系数据库支持多用户并发访问,通过事务机制保证了数据的并发一致性。

关系数据库的缺点包括:

1、数据存储冗余度高:关系数据库中每个关系都对应一张二维表,数据存储冗余度高,浪费了存储空间。

2、数据更新复杂:关系数据库中数据的更新需要同时更新多个关系,数据更新复杂,容易出现数据不一致的问题。

3、查询效率低:关系数据库中查询需要对多个关系进行连接操作,查询效率低,特别是在数据量较大的情况下。

4、不适合处理复杂的数据结构:关系数据库不适合处理复杂的数据结构,如树形结构、网状结构等。

为了解决关系数据库的缺点,人们提出了一些新的数据库技术,如对象关系数据库、面向对象数据库、分布式数据库等,这些数据库技术在数据存储、数据更新、查询效率和数据结构等方面都有了很大的改进和提高。

关系数据库是一种非常重要的数据库技术,它具有数据结构简单、数据独立性高、数据一致性好、数据操作方便和支持多用户并发访问等优点,被广泛应用于企业管理、金融、电信、医疗等领域,关系数据库也存在一些缺点,需要人们不断地探索和创新,以提高数据库技术的性能和应用范围。

标签: #关系数据库 #基本数据单位 #数据 #关系

黑狐家游戏
  • 评论列表

留言评论